FDA APPROVES ALCON'S CATARACT DEVICE

The FDA recently announced approval of a lens to improve cataract patients' vision. The agency will allow Alcon to use its AcrySof Toric intraocular lens (IOL) for cataract patients with pre-existing corneal astigmatism. The company is planning a commercial launch of the product in conjunction with the annual meeting of the American Society of Cataract and Refractive Surgeons in March 2006.
